Bukit Panjang station in detail

Bukit Panjang sits at the north-western end of the Downtown Line, underneath the Bukit Panjang Integrated Transport Hub. It shares its name — but not its concourse — with the Bukit Panjang LRT station next door: the two are linked by a covered walkway rather than a shared paid area, so changing between the DTL and the LRT means tapping out and tapping back in, with 15 minutes to do so for it to count as a single journey. The station opens directly into Hillion Mall, with the bus interchange and Bukit Panjang Plaza a short walk beyond. For residents of the surrounding new town this is the main gateway south into the city, and the interchange point for the LRT's loop through Senja, Petir and the rest of the estate.

Fares and travel times from Bukit Panjang
| To | Distance | Adult fare | Before 07:45 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Dhoby Ghaut | 15.8 km | S$2.11 | S$1.61 |
| City Hall | 17.1 km | S$2.15 | S$1.65 |
| Raffles Place | 18.0 km | S$2.20 | S$1.70 |
| Orchard | 14.1 km | S$2.02 | S$1.52 |
| Jurong East | 6.9 km | S$1.68 | S$1.18 |
| Changi Airport | 31.5 km | S$2.48 | S$1.98 |
| Bayfront | 18.9 km | S$2.24 | S$1.74 |
| HarbourFront | 17.6 km | S$2.20 | S$1.70 |
Indicative distance-based card fares. Tap in before 07:45 on a weekday and 50 cents comes off any fare. Work out an exact route in the route planner.

Time your transfer to the LRT carefully: the covered walkway outside the gates takes a few minutes, and that's part of the 15-minute window. The loop runs both ways, so check the platform display before boarding, or you'll end up going the long way round.

Bukit Panjang — frequently asked questions
Yes. Bukit Panjang (DT1/BP6) is where the Downtown Line meets the Bukit Panjang LRT, but the two are not in the same paid area — you tap out at the MRT gates, walk a short covered linkway, and tap in again at the LRT. Do this within 15 minutes and it still counts as a single fare.
Hillion Mall sits directly above the concourse, with a supermarket, food court and clinics. Bukit Panjang Plaza is a few minutes’ walk further along Jelapang Road, and the bus interchange is right beside the station for onward connections across the north-west of the island.
Bukit Panjang is the western terminus of the Downtown Line. Trains run from here south-east through Bukit Timah and the city centre before turning east to Tampines and Expo, a journey of about 69 minutes end to end if you rode the whole line.
